    Description

    Celebrate Groundhog Day with this fun and educational NO PREP bundle of activities for grades 4-7.

    Engage in close reading, collage art, math, writing, logic puzzles, and more! Perfect for classrooms or homeschooling.

    By purchasing this BUNDLE, you are saving 20% off each resource!

    Close-Reading and Collage Art Activities Include:

    • Activities 1a and 2a| ASK | Read |” Discovering the Fascinating History of Paper!” and “What Is a Groundhog? Exploring the World of These Furry Creatures”
    • Activity 1b | UNDERSTAND | Vocabulary Match
    • Activity 2b | RECALL | Find Sentences in a Paragraph
    • Activity 3 | CREATE | Design a Groundhog Collage!

    1+ Hour Activity (Can be taught all at once or separately)

    Let students work at their own pace, in centers, for homework or as a whole group. This is an engaging & flexible unit!

    Close-Reading, Math, and Writing Activities Include:

    • Activities 1a and 1b| ASK | Read | ”Celebrating Groundhog Day: A Tradition that Brings Joy!” and “Groundhog Day: Can a Groundhog Predict the Weather?”
    • Activity 2 | RECALL | Complete a Multiple-Choice Quiz
    • Activity 3 | APPLY | Solve Math Equation Picture Puzzles
    • Activity 4 | ANALYZE | Use Pig Pen Cipher to Solve Riddles BREAK THE CODE!
    • Activity 5 | ANALYZE | Use Deductive Logic to Solve a Logic Puzzle
    • Activity 6a |APPLY | Groundhog Day Word Search
    • Activity 6b | APPLY| Groundhog Day | Use Words in Context
    • Activity 7 | CREATE | Write an Acrostic Poem
    • BONUS Activity | Opinion Writing Organizer | Writing Prompt- Best Season, Winter or Spring?

    This packet is perfect for sub plans, Literacy centers, group work, independent work or early finishers

    6 separate activities

    Approximately 2+ Hours Worth of Activities (Can be completed all at once or separately)
